I have a Canon elph sd550? (7.1 MPxl.) I love it but I would suggest any small camera have the Optical Image Stabilization feature. I've lost a few good shots that the OIS would have saved but it wasn't available when I bought mine. Any of the Canons with an "IS" after model number have that feature. I just bought my daughter a S5is and it's absolutely awesome. Very close to DSLR in operation and outcome. The Canon SD / S series are made in Japan, the A series are made in China and there is a difference in build quality.
